Onion Bread Mix in a Jar
1/4 c dehydrated onion flakes
3 1/3 c bread flour
2 tbs sugar
1 tbs powdered milk
1 1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p dried sage, optional
1 envelope of yeast

Place the onion flakes in a small zip-close bag and set aside. Combine the the other ingredients, except for the yeast, into a quart jar. Add the bag of onions and the yeast to the top of the mix and close the jar. Store the mix in a cool, dry place.

Include the following directions:

Onion Bread Mix

1 jar of onion bread mix
1 1/8 cups warm water (105-110°F)
1 tablespoon vegetable oil

Follow your bread maker instructions. For most bread makers, place the water and oil into the bread pan, then add the dry ingredients on top, add the yeast last. Bake as for "white" bread.

To make without a breadmaker, just mix ingredients as you would for white bread. Knead, let rise, punch down and form loaf and place in greased pan. Let rise again and bake in a 350°F oven for 30 minutes or until golden brown and loaf sounds hollow when tapped.
